Output 17af84d18273fa74d6287330391ca133aa6d21fdb88144a9b6233e47291c561b:0

value
4000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a190e245f3efd469650a7d4499c3546184d3f142 OP_EQUALVERIFY OP_CHECKSIG
address
1FjHMbQNTvHTpgLJoy8xpgFaSnTGJSiKyZ
transaction
17af84d18273fa74d6287330391ca133aa6d21fdb88144a9b6233e47291c561b
confirmations
747467
spent
true